Dental Implants Need Care Too: What healing, maintenance, and long-term success really involve

A dental implant can be an excellent way to replace a missing tooth, but it is not a maintenance-free or indestructible substitute. Understanding how an implant heals - and how it differs from a natural tooth - can help you protect it for the long term.

First, what is a dental implant?
The word implant is often used to describe the whole replacement tooth, but the restoration is actually a small system. The implant fixture is the root-shaped part placed in the jawbone. An abutment connects to the implant, and the crown is the visible tooth-shaped part you bite and smile with.
Each part has a different job. The implant must remain stable in bone, the surrounding gum must stay healthy, and the crown and connecting screw must tolerate chewing forces. Long-term success depends on all of these parts working together.
Osseointegration: how the implant becomes stable
After the implant is placed, the surrounding bone heals and forms a close biological connection to its surface. This process is called osseointegration. At first, the implant is held mainly by the mechanical grip created during placement. As bone remodels, some of that early stability can decrease before new biological stability becomes stronger.
That transition is one reason your dental team may ask you to avoid chewing hard foods on the area or disturbing it during healing. An implant can feel comfortable while important changes are still occurring below the gum. Comfort alone does not prove that the implant is ready for its final crown.
WHY THE TIMELINE IS INDIVIDUALIZED
There is no single healing time that applies to every implant. Bone quality, implant location, grafting, initial stability, medical history, tobacco exposure, diabetes control, medications, and the planned restoration can all affect the schedule. The surgeon and restoring dentist determine when it is appropriate to proceed.
Can an implant and tooth be placed on the same day?
Sometimes. Immediate implant placement, an immediate temporary tooth, or immediate loading can be appropriate in carefully selected situations. However, receiving a tooth quickly does not mean that biological healing has already finished. The temporary restoration may need to be kept out of heavy contact while the implant integrates.
In other situations, a staged approach is safer: extraction, bone or soft-tissue healing when needed, implant placement, osseointegration, and then the final crown. The best sequence is the one that gives your individual site the most predictable result, not necessarily the shortest calendar.
Four common implant myths
- Myth: Every missing tooth can receive an immediate implant and final crown. Reality: Same-day treatment is possible only when the site, implant stability, bite, and patient factors allow it. Even then, bone healing continues for weeks or months.
- Myth: Implants are easier to clean than natural teeth. Reality: They cannot develop a cavity, but plaque can still inflame the gum and damage supporting bone. Cleaning must be thorough and tailored to the shape of the restoration.
- Myth: An implant is a one-time expense with no future care. Reality: The implant fixture may function for many years, but the crown, screw, or other components can wear, loosen, chip, or require replacement. Professional maintenance remains important.
- Myth: Once the crown is attached, regular dental visits are optional. Reality: Checkups allow the dental team to monitor the gum, bone, bite, cleanliness, crown, and connecting components before a small concern becomes a larger one.
How is an implant different from a natural tooth?
A natural tooth is suspended in bone by a periodontal ligament. This tiny ligament contains fibres and sensory receptors, allows a small amount of movement, and helps the tooth respond to biting pressure. A dental implant is connected directly to bone and does not have that same ligament.
The gum seal around an implant is also organized differently from the attachment around a natural tooth. It still acts as a protective barrier, but it may be more vulnerable to plaque and inflammation. Because implants move less than teeth, your dentist also pays close attention to the bite when the crown is placed and during future checkups.
AN IMPORTANT BENEFIT - AND AN IMPORTANT LIMITATION
The implant and its crown cannot decay like a natural tooth. That is valuable, especially for people at high risk of cavities or dry mouth. However, being cavity-resistant does not make the implant immune to gum inflammation, bone loss, mechanical wear, or complications.
What can happen around an implant?
Bacterial plaque can collect where the crown meets the gum. Early inflammation limited to the soft tissue is called peri-implant mucositis. It may cause redness, swelling, or bleeding and can often be controlled when it is recognized early and the causes are addressed.
Peri-implantitis involves inflammation together with progressive loss of supporting bone. It is more difficult to treat and may require care from a dentist or periodontist with experience in implant complications. Previous gum disease, poor plaque control, smoking, and poorly controlled diabetes are among the factors associated with higher risk.
DO NOT WAIT FOR PAIN
Implant disease may develop with little or no discomfort. Bleeding during cleaning, swelling, pus, recession, a persistent bad taste, food trapping, or a loose-feeling crown should be assessed even if the implant does not hurt.
Your everyday implant-care routine
The correct cleaning tools depend on whether you have a single crown, an implant bridge, or a full-arch restoration. Your dental hygienist can select devices that fit the space without damaging the tissue or restoration. A typical plan may include:
- Brush twice daily: Use a soft toothbrush or power brush and clean carefully where the crown meets the gum.
- Clean between teeth every day: Floss, implant-specific floss, an interdental brush, or a water flosser may be recommended depending on the shape and access.
- Protect the tissues: Use the size and technique demonstrated by your dental team. A device that is too large or used forcefully can cause trauma; one that is too small may leave plaque behind.
- Control modifiable risks: Avoid tobacco, work with your physician to manage diabetes, and tell your dentist about medical or medication changes that may affect healing.
- Attend individualized maintenance visits: Your recall interval should reflect your gum history, home-care effectiveness, implant design, and risk factors rather than a one-size-fits-all schedule.
What your dental team checks
At implant maintenance visits, the team may examine plaque levels, bleeding, tissue shape, probing measurements, the fit and stability of the restoration, and changes in your bite. Radiographs are taken when clinically indicated to compare the supporting bone with previous records. Establishing a healthy baseline after the crown is placed makes future comparisons more meaningful.
When should you contact the dental office?
- The crown or implant feels loose, mobile, or different when you bite.
- Your bite suddenly feels high or uncomfortable.
- The gum repeatedly bleeds, swells, recedes, or releases fluid or pus.
- You notice persistent pain, pressure, a bad taste, or an odour from the area.
- Food begins collecting around the crown or your usual floss or brush no longer passes normally.
- The crown chips, fractures, or feels rough.
The bottom line
Dental implants are highly useful restorations, but they are not set-it-and-forget-it devices. Protecting the healing phase, cleaning the implant every day, controlling health risks, and maintaining regular professional reviews all matter. The goal is not simply to keep the implant in the mouth; it is to keep the surrounding tissue, bone, bite, and restoration healthy and comfortable.
